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1 to 2, the present invention provides a technical solution: a traction frame for orthopedic clinical use comprises a traction plate 1 and a chute 2, wherein the chute 2 is arranged on the surface of the traction plate 1;
in order to limit the positions of the legs of the patient by the traction frame and prevent the legs from shaking, the inner wall of the sliding groove 2 is movably connected with a limiting plate 3, and the positions of the limiting plate 3 in the sliding groove 2 can be adjusted through the matching arrangement of the traction plate 1, the sliding groove 2 and the limiting plate 3, so that the positions of the limiting plate 3 can be adjusted conveniently according to the size of the legs of the patient, the legs of the patient can be limited, and the legs of the patient are prevented from shaking left and right to influence the recovery of the legs of the patient;
in order to enable the traction frame to adjust the height position of the supporting pad 5, the inner wall of the traction plate 1 is movably connected with a traction rope 4, the two ends of the traction rope 4 are fixedly connected with the supporting pad 5, the upper surface of the traction plate 1 is fixedly connected with eight clamping columns 6, the surface of one clamping column 6 is lapped with the traction rope 4, and the height of the supporting pad 5 can be adjusted by lapping the traction rope 4 and the clamping columns 6 at different positions through the matching arrangement of the traction rope 4, the supporting pad 5 and the clamping columns 6, so that the traction frame is convenient for orthopedic patients to use;
in order to enable the traction frame to be capable of installing beds with different widths, a connecting column 7 is movably connected to the inner wall of a traction plate 1 through a bolt, the traction frame can be adjusted according to the width of a bed body to be installed by adjusting the position of the connecting column 7 inside the traction plate 1 through the matching arrangement between the traction plate 1 and the connecting column 7, so that the traction frame can be installed on the beds with different widths and is convenient to use, one end, away from the traction plate 1, of the connecting column 7 is fixedly connected with a connecting plate 8, one side of the connecting plate 8 is movably connected with a loop bar 9 through a bolt, the inner wall of the loop bar 9 is movably connected with a supporting rod 10, the surface thread of the loop bar 9 is connected with an adjusting bolt 11, one side of the supporting rod 10 is fixedly connected with a fixed frame 12, the inner bottom wall of the fixed frame 12 is connected with a fixed bolt, the top of the limiting plate 3 is movably connected with the upper surface of the traction plate 1 through a bolt, and an adjusting bolt 11 penetrates through the loop bar 9 and is in threaded connection with the inner wall of the supporting rod 10.
